: Dec 2011 milestone Switched to using the L3U single-pass SST imagery produced for IMOS by BoM cbr.act.csiro.au:8080/thredds/catalog/imos/GHRSST/L3U/catalo g.htmlhttp://aodaac2- cbr.act.csiro.au:8080/thredds/catalog/imos/GHRSST/L3U/catalo g.html This enabled high-res zooms for Esperance, GAB, Tasmania Insert presentation title
2011 – other progress Switched to using the NOAA Radar Altimetry Database System (RADS) – keeps us up-to-date with the latest corrections, for all altimeters Started including Cryosat altimeter in near-real-time analysis on 9 Dec The earned us a mention on the ESA News page.
